Etymology

First attested as Philipsdorp in 1926. Compound of Philips (a surname) and dorp (village). Named after a complex of factory housing constructed for employees of the Philips electronics company. Compare Agodorp, Batadorp and Heveadorp.

Proper noun

Philipsdorp n

  1. A neighbourhood of Eindhoven, Noord-Brabant, Netherlands.
